8,256,086,673,021 is an odd composite number composed of five prime numbers multiplied together.
8256086673021 is an odd compos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of forty-eight divisors.
Prime factorization of 8256086673021:
32 × 11 × 3673 × 1693 × 13411

To count from 1 to 8,256,086,673,021 would take you about six hundred fifty-six thousand, two hundred ninety-five years!
This is a very rough estimate, based on a speaking rate of half a second every third order of magnitude. If you speak quickly, you could probably say any randomly-chosen number between one and a thousand in around half a second. Very big numbers obviously take longer to say, so we add half a second for every extra x1000. (We do not count involuntary pauses, bathroom breaks or the necessity of sleep in our calculation!)
